Quality Control Supervisor oversees and monitors the inspection and testing of materials, parts, and products to ensure adherence to established quality standards. Establishes inspection protocols, defines sampling procedures, and determines equipment and mechanisms to be used in the testing process. Being a Quality Control Supervisor recommends changes in specifications of materials, parts, and products based on inspection results. May formulate and revise quality control policies and procedures. Additionally, Quality Control Supervisor, a level I supervisor is considered a working supervisor with little authority for personnel actions. May require a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a manager or head of a unit/department. Working team member that may validate or coordinate the work of others on a support team. Suggests improvements to process, is a knowledge resource for other team members. Has no authority for staff actions. Generally has a minimum of 2 years experience as an individual contributor. Thorough knowledge of the team processes.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)

Supervisor, Quality Control Laboratory
  • San Diego Blood Bank
  • San Diego, CA FULL_TIME
  • JOB SUMMARY
    • Oversee the daily operation of the department.
    • Assist with coordinating staff schedules, work assignments, and workload.
      • Assist with coordinating projects and activities in conjunction with department Manager.
    • Assist with interviewing, hiring, and training of new personnel.
      • Supports the Lab Management Team, SDBB safety, cGMP and SDBB Quality Plan.
    RESPONSIBILITIES
    • Adheres to current good manufacturing practices (cGMP) guidelines.
    • Adheres to CUA, AABB, FDA, and other applicable requirements for testing.
      • Must demonstrate and uphold the SDBB's Standards of Excellence.
      • Supervise the flow of samples, blood, and blood components through the department from satellite centers, mobile collection vehicles, hospitals, blood banks, and laboratories.
      • Supervise and adjust, as needed, the work assignments of staff to best meet the needs of the department and San Diego Blood Bank's operations
      • Maintain communication channels between lab areas to ensure a high level of service.
      • Provide input on departmental policies and procedures.
      • Responsible for reviewing daily records and reports, and taking the appropriate action based on the available data.
      • Ability to work with a variety of temperature monitoring systems and effectively deal with equipment situations that arise.
      • Assist with the employee performance evaluations and rounding for staff.
      • Conduct counseling, coaching and disciplining of personnel in accordance with current department and organizational policies and procedures.
    • Assist management by drafting new or revisions to controlled documents.
      • Assist management with validations and re-qualifications of equipment.
      • Assist with the roll out of new or updated software.
      • Keep management apprised of any situations or circumstances that arise that could have a negative impact on the department or organization's operation.
      • Finalize investigation, evaluation, CAPA and final review for quality and error events.
      • Perform supervisory evaluation of QIRs.
      • Oversee Q&D process for lab.
    • Assist with department staff meetings and attend other meetings as assigned.
      • Enhance professional growth and development of staff and self.
      • Support and comply with SDBB affirmative action policy.
      • Perform other related duties as assigned or requested.
    Additional Job Accountabilities:
    • Supervises daily platelet production, labeling and quarantine/disposition activity.
    • Supervises product quality control testing, reporting, trending and monthly summary.
    • Supervises the Laboratory quality control, maintenance and validation processes.
    • Assist Manager and/or Assistant Manager with staff scheduling and controlled document writing.
    • Assist department Trainer with staff training and competency.
    • Assist Management with equipment calibrations and periodic NIST - certifications for QC Lab

    WORKING ENVIRONMENT

    • Normal laboratory environment with biohazard precautions.
    • May be exposed to the risk of blood borne diseases.
    • May be exposed to chemicals that may be hazardous.
    • May be called on to work or attend meetings at other than routinely scheduled hours.

    P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S

    • Must be able to perform physical laboratory procedures when necessary.
    • Must be able to work on a computer 4 - 8 hours a day.
    • Must be able to move around office and attend meetings outside of office.
    • Ability to travel to other SDBB sites as needed.

    EQUIPMENT USED

    • Standard office equipment including personal computer, faxes and printers.
    • Label printing equipment.
    • General laboratory equipment including but not limited to: hematology cell counters, residual cell counters, bacterial detection analyzers, pH meter, centrifuges, water baths, cell washers, timers, microscopes, glass viewer, heat sealers, sterile docking devices, refrigerators/freezers, sterility incubators, tubing strippers, weights, scales, balances, expressors -if applicable in the lab department.
    • BEGS (Blood Establishment Computer Systems)

    QUALIFICATIONS

    • Advanced level of understanding of the technical aspects of the lab department, blood banking concepts, component manufacturing, and cGMP regulations.
    • Knowledge and application of standards and regulations that apply to blood banking (FDA, AABB, OSHA, SOS, and others as needed).
    • Must be keenly detail-oriented, well-organized, self-motivated, flexible and capable of independent work with changing priorities, and display good time management skills.
    • Must be able to direct workflow and perform advanced troubleshooting of scientifically technical problems.
    • Interpersonal skills to establish and maintain professional relationships.
    • Professional communication both written and oral, which is clear and precise.
    • Integrity and discretion - ability to maintain confidentiality and cGMP compliance.
    • Ability to perform under pressure and work under stressful situations.
    • Critical thinking, creativity and innovation.
    • Decision-making skills. Uses authority appropriately in making sound judgments in a timely manner. Accepts accountability.
    • Flexibility - ability to effectively manage change and positively influence others.
    Education:
    • Bachelor of Science required
    Experience:
    • Minimum 2 years in blood bank related fields to include leadership experience (laboratory, supervisory and/or regulatory) and IRL experience, if applicable to department.
    Certifications/Licenses:
    • MLS(ASCP)Cm / MT(ASCP), or equivalent experience
    • California Clinical Laboratory Scientist License (CLS) required
    • Specialist in Blood Banking (SBB) or equivalent education preferred

According to SDSU professor emeritus Monte Marshall, San Diego Bay is "the surface expression of a north-south-trending, nested graben". The Rose Canyon and Point Loma fault zones are part of the San Andreas Fault system. About 40 miles (64 km) east of the bay are the Laguna Mountains in the Peninsular Ranges, which are part of the backbone of the American continents. The city lies on approximately 200 deep canyons and hills separating its mesas, creating small pockets of natural open space scattered throughout the city and giving it a hilly geography.
